"Oracle基础知识学习笔记及数据库核心概念详解"

1 下载量 111 浏览量 更新于2024-01-05 收藏 137KB DOC 举报
Oracle基础知识学习笔记 本文总结了关于Oracle数据库的基础知识,包括基本概念、数据库管理系统、关系数据库、SQL语句和Oracle数据库的核心组件。 首先,文章介绍了一些基本概念。数据是用于描述事物的符号,而数据库是用于存放数据的地方,它由数据和数据库对象组成。数据库管理系统(DBMS)是一种计算机软件,用于管理数据,使用户能够方便地定义和操作数据,维护数据的安全性和完整性,并进行多用户下的并发控制和数据库恢复。关系数据库(RDB)是基于关系模型的数据库。 接下来,文章介绍了SQL语句的三种类型。数据定义语句(DDL)用于创建、删除、修改和截断表等操作,这些操作不能回滚。数据操作语句(DML)用于插入、查询、更新和删除数据,以及合并数据。数据控制语句(DCL)用于授权和回收权限。事务控制语句用于提交、回滚和保存点的操作。 然后,文章介绍了Oracle数据库的核心组件。数据字典(DD)是数据库的元数据,它存储了关于数据库对象的信息。动态性能表(DPT)提供了关于数据库性能的实时信息。触发器是一种特殊的数据库对象,它与表相关联,当满足特定条件时,触发器会自动执行相应的操作。PL/SQL包是存储过程和函数的容器,它可以被其他程序调用。 最后,文章介绍了Oracle数据库中的用户和角色。角色是一组权限的集合,常见的角色包括dba、connect、resource、exp_full_database和imp_full_database。用户分为sys和system两种,他们具有超级管理员权限。用户权限包括两种:系统权限和对象权限,系统权限是指对数据库的整体操作权限,对象权限是指对其他用户对象的访问权限。 综上所述,本文总结了关于Oracle数据库的基础知识,包括基本概念、数据库管理系统、关系数据库、SQL语句和Oracle数据库的核心组件。同时,介绍了Oracle数据库中的用户和角色。这些知识对于熟悉和使用Oracle数据库的人员来说是非常重要的。希望该笔记能够帮助读者更好地理解和应用Oracle数据库。